I'm reluctant to stack even table models on top of consoles. I currently have a 1937 Zenith 5 tube radio and a 1960 Zenith 7 tube radio on top of the CTC-25, and that seems to be its limit. The CTC-120 seems to be a little more resilient to weight - I have a 1977 RCA VBT-200 and a 1985 RCA CTC-117 on top of it, and it doesn't look too stressed out. Do y'all think the Zenith Chromacolor has a 23EC15 or a 25EC58 chassis? I really hope it's the former.

Console is probably a 25EC58 BUT mid year on
these sets were changed over to the upright 25EC45.
Could be a C or D line also. Near identical electronics.
Its NOT a remote set. Remotes have no expossed knobs. There
would be a long up & down window for the channel numbers,
14 position IIRC.

Table model is apx Y line custom series with 9-181 main board.
Solid set but bottom of line & wickid common.
